UNIGLOBE Travel signs worldwide agreement with Exclusively Hotels for hotel reservations

UNIGLOBE Travel International has signed a long-term agreement with Exclusively Hotels, who will provide UNIGLOBE Travel with its reservation platform dedicated for travel agents.

Exclusively Hotels is TotalStayGroup’s trade-only reservation platform and the agreement with Exclusively Hotels makes the system available to every UNIGLOBE Travel Agency in its global network spanning over 30 countries worldwide. Exclusively Hotels currently features over 45,000 properties with guaranteed availability in 3,500 destinations worldwide. UNIGLOBE travel consultants will be able to confirm bookings instantly for clients.

“This deal will allow all our franchisees to deliver an improved accommodation booking service to their clients by offering highly competitive rates and instant confirmation. UNIGLOBE is committed to providing the best possible service to our clients and this deal will ensure that we continue to fulfill this commitment,” said Amanda J. Close, vice president, Global Operations & Regional Services at UNIGLOBE Travel International.

About UNIGLOBE Travel International Limited Partnership
UNIGLOBE Travel International Limited Partnership is the leading international travel management system that specializes in providing travel services to the small to mid-size enterprise (SME) market. The travel franchise organization has over 700 locations in more than 30 countries in the Americas, Europe, Asia, and Africa. Operating under a well-recognized brand name, UNIGLOBE travel agencies specialize in providing travel management services to corporate accounts and to leisure travellers. UNIGLOBE Travel International has its world headquarters in Vancouver, BC, Canada. More information at www.uniglobetravel.com.

About TotalStayGroup:
TotalStayGroup is the parent company of some of the industry’s leading travel companies with solutions for consumers, travel agents and strategic partners. Active since 1999, it offers a portfolio of over 45,000 hotels, resorts, inns, villas and apartments in 11 languages at present.
